CVE-2010-4750: Cross-site request forgery (CSRF) vulnerability in admin/libs/ADMIN.php in BLOG:CMS 4.2.1.e, and possibly e...

Cross-site request forgery (CSRF) vulnerability in admin/libs/ADMIN.php in BLOG:CMS 4.2.1.e, and possibly earlier, allows remote attackers to hijack the authentication of administrators.

This is a CSRF issue in BLOG:CMS administration code. If an administrator is already logged in, a remote attacker could abuse that trusted browser session. The source bundle does not provide a CVSS score, a confirmed fixed version, or evidence of active exploitation. Exposure is likely limited to organizations still running BLOG:CMS 4.2.1.e or possibly earlier with reachable administrator functionality. Treat as a legacy-web-application risk. Prioritize discovery and retirement or isolation of any remaining BLOG:CMS admin surfaces, especially internet-facing ones. Mitigation focus: Inventory for BLOG:CMS 4.2.1.e and possibly earlier installations.; Check BLOG:CMS or maintainer guidance for a fixed release; sources do not name one.; Restrict access to the BLOG:CMS administrator interface..
